Responsibilities
- Operate and optimize high-volume manufacturing equipment and processes to ensure control over critical dimensions and defectivity.
- Conduct tests and measurements to evaluate equipment and process performance, recommending and implementing modifications to enhance productivity and quality.
- Lead the execution of maintenance and repair activities for assigned equipment and modules.
- Drive continuous improvement initiatives to optimize safety, productivity, cost, and yield, collaborating with internal teams and external suppliers.
- Develop and implement excursion prevention systems to detect and address discrepant material or activities associated with the equipment and process.
- Support the transfer of technology to manufacturing sites worldwide through training, audits, and documentation to ensure consistent processing across locations.
- Own the installation, conversion, and qualification of equipment during factory ramps, ensuring compliance with safety and quality standards.
- Leverage data-driven techniques, such as Design of Experiments (DOE), to characterize, control, and improve manufacturing processes.
